Action item (owner: gateway team, due before next release): the Corvette gateway applied per-pod rather than global rate limits during the incident, allowing downstream saturation when pods scaled up. We will switch to the shared token-bucket backend and add a regression test. Rollout plan and verification checklist for the release are documented on the following internal page.

operations page: https://jira.qorvelsys.internal/browse/pages/browse/pages

The revamped password reset flow in the Lockstone API replaces emailed links with short-lived reset grants. Plugins initiate a reset by posting the account handle to the reset endpoint, then poll the grant status until the user confirms out-of-band. Grants expire after ten minutes and are single-use; a consumed grant returns a terminal status rather than an error. All reset endpoints require plugin-level authentication via the bearer token shown below.

bearer token for yajop-tahop: eyJhbGciOiJIUzI1NiIsInR5cCI6IkpXVCJ9.eyJzdWIiOiIC9r503In0.M9JwY-EN

Looks good overall, but please don't hardcode the lint thresholds inside each rule for the Bramblewood SQL linter. Future maintainers will want one place to adjust max line length, join depth, and identifier casing checks, especially once the Ketterly schema migration lands. Pull them into the shared constants module so CI and local runs stay in sync. For reference, the agreed values are as follows.

constants for bagaf-hadup:
QUOTAS = {
    "quenael": 1,
    "ralwyn": 1,
    "oliath": 2,
    "ulaael": 2,
}

## Onboarding: Transcode Farm Releases

Welcome. As release manager for the Arbelline transcode farm, you own the weekly worker-image rollout. Builds come off the Norvik pipeline, pass conformance tests against the reference clip set, and land in the staging registry. Your job is to promote a tested image to production and monitor queue drain during the swap. Promotion requires a signed manifest; unsigned manifests are rejected by every node. To sign the promotion manifest, use the deploy key provided below.

signing key of bagap-yawep = bky13_TbfT6ZMUoGJo2